Colour-tutorial FINALY finished!

After spending an inordinate amount of time rewriting and improving my colour-tutorial, I’ve finally uploaded it to the (new) article>design section YAY!

Highlights:
- Added a test you can use to figure out your own colour preferences, utilize your collection better, and begin collecting more strategically
- Cut out some of the more speculative stuff regarding mixed colours and the 3-colour rule I wrote about in an earlier post.
- I’ve added a page on what you can use colourschemes for.
- I’ve added a couple of practical examples on how you can actually work with colourschemes in real life and get fairly decent colourschemes.
- Finally I’ve added a page with condensations of good colour-advice from CSF and links to further colour-resources.
